Skip to Content

Does Peppermint Oil Keep Spiders Away? (Explained)

Spiders are very bothersome, and an infestation in your home can easily get out of control real soon. So you should do something about a spider infestation as soon as you notice them. 

In this article, we will discuss whether peppermint oil can keep spiders away. We will further take a look into the reasons behind its effects and how you can use peppermint oil to repel spiders from your home. 

Does peppermint oil keep spiders away?

Peppermint oil will keep spiders away. It’s still not clear why spiders steer clear of peppermint oil. But you can make a spider-repellant solution by adding 5 drops of peppermint oil with 16-ounces of water. Strategically placing it around the house will repel spiders from your house. 

Peppermint oil can keep spiders away very effectively. There are many people who are creeped out by this eight-legged creature. And a spider infestation makes their homes a very unfriendly territory. But there’s a very simple workaround to it. 

You can simply use peppermint oil to keep spiders away from your home. This essential oil works like magic in keeping spiders away from any given territory. This essential oil has been used to repel spiders for a long time now. 

And it has consistently proven to be effective. It has been seen that peppermint spray repels spiders and ants for up to a week without any issue. This oil is good for repelling other home invaders as well. 

Diffusing peppermint oil:

Diffusing peppermint oil has proven to be effective in keeping spiders away. Diffusing these essential oils will keep spiders away without much issue. 

Spiders strongly dislike the smell of peppermint oil and diffusing it will annoy them, eventually driving them away. 

Peppermint oil is a natural insecticide. You can simply diffuse it and the oil will get to work. It will keep spiders away from your home and yard for at least a week. 

Spraying peppermint oil:

Spraying peppermint oil is another effective way of keeping spiders away from your territory. Spiders dislike the smell of peppermint oil. It is too strong for them. 

So spiders fend off when they smell peppermint oil. You can simply produce a solution by mixing a few drops of peppermint oil with water and contain it in a spray bottle. 

Spray the oil solution strategically around your house to drive the spiders away in the shortest possible time. 

How long does peppermint oil keep spiders away? How often to use peppermint oil for spiders? 

Peppermint oil is a very effective solution for keeping spiders away. If you spray the peppermint oil solution once around the house, it will keep spiders away from your home for about two weeks

You will have to be very strategic during spraying the solution around your home. The peppermint oil has a very strong smell and it can end up bothering you as well. So you might want to be careful not to overflow your home with this oil solution. 

While you are spraying the peppermint oil solution, you may notice that spiders are moving around your house looking for a new shelter since their old one has been compromised. In such a situation, avoid stomping on the spider. 

Let them move about freely. If they cannot find a spot to hide within your home, which they should not be able to, thanks to the peppermint spray, they will eventually move out. So you will not have to worry about removing the spiders yourself. 

If the spider infestation is severe, then you should spray peppermint oil around your house a few times, keeping a two weeks interval in between. Repeat the process a couple of times and you will be able to remove all the spiders from your home.

Where do you put peppermint oil to deter spiders?

To deter spiders from your home, you will have to put peppermint oil very strategically. You cannot overflow your home with this oil as it has a very strong smell that will end up being bothersome for you and your family. 

You can put this oil around the perimeter of your home. Make sure that you are covering every corner around your house. 

Now you will need to identify where the spiders are coming from. They must have built some safe places for themselves. You will have to invade those and put peppermint oil there.

Make sure to apply the spray in the dark hole, cracks and crevices in and around your home. Do not miss any dark corner while you are working on it. Ensuring such a thorough spraying process will soon eliminate all the spiders from your home. 

Does peppermint oil keep these spiders out? 

Peppermint oil has been known to keep spiders away. But it cannot keep all spiders away from your home, that’s for sure. Let’s take a look at some spiders and analyze whether peppermint oil can keep these spiders out. 

Wolf spider:

Yes, peppermint oil will keep wolf spiders out without any trouble. You can repel them by spraying some peppermint solution around the house. 

Make a solution of peppermint oil and water and spray it around the region where spiders have infested your home. This will soon drive the wolf spiders out. You should repeat the process after two weeks for the best results. 

Brown recluse spider:

Yes, peppermint oil will keep brown recluse spiders away. You can quickly drive them away by using some peppermint oil spray. It will drive the brown recluse spider in no time. 

Not only peppermint oil, but other essential oils are also effective in keeping these spiders away. Hedge apples will also repel these spiders without any trouble. 

2 reasons why peppermint oil keeps spiders away – How does peppermint oil keep spiders away?

Spiders dislike peppermint oil. There are several reasons behind it. Let’s discuss some of the most prominent reasons why peppermint oil keeps spiders away. 


Spiders dislike the smell of peppermint oil. The smell is too strong for them. It is an overpowering smell that drives spiders out of their homes. 

So we leverage that and use peppermint oil as a weapon to drive spiders away from our homes. Spider infestation can get very ugly real soon. So it is best to take action as soon as we notice an infestation instead of letting it grow. 


Spiders also dislike the taste of peppermint oil. And since they can taste with their legs, the taste of peppermint oil bothers them whenever they are moving around the house. 

The taste of peppermint oil is very overpowering. It does not suit the taste of spiders. So they move away from the region where there is peppermint oil. 

How do you use peppermint oil to keep spiders away? 

Here are some of the most effective steps that you will need to follow to learn how to use peppermint oil to keep spiders away from your home. Read ahead to learn more about it: 

Clean your home: 

The first step will be to clean and dust your home properly. You will have to clean the house thoroughly and dust every corner in order to get rid of the spider webs and their houses. 

Spiders love to set their webs in the corners, especially when it is dusty. So you will first have to eliminate their comfort zone from your home. Then you can proceed to eliminating them entirely.  

Prepare a solution: 

Now you will have to prepare a solution that will work as a spider repellent. Spiders dislike the smell and taste of peppermint oil. Use it to your advantage. 

Add five drops of peppermint oil with about 16 ounces of water. Mix it well. Transfer the peppermint oil solution in a spray bottle. Then let the solution sit in a spray bottle for a couple of hours. 

Spray the peppermint oil: 

Now it’s time to spray the peppermint oil around your house. Make sure to cover every corner. Spray the solution around the perimeter of the house at first, then eventually move inward. 

Make sure to spray the oil in every hole, cracks, and corner of the house, especially the ones that are in the dark. Those are the comfort zones of spiders. Once you have sprayed the solution thoroughly, wait for about 2 weeks before repeating the process. 

Final Thoughts 

Peppermint oil will keep spiders away. But you will have to be very strategic with it. You don’t want to overuse it, and it is very easy to underuse it as well. Prepare a solution and spray it along the perimeter of your home. Make sure to cover all the holes and dark corners in the house as well.